Greg L. Masingo, born on January 10, 1961, in Jeffersonville, Indiana, departed from this world unexpectedly on September 23, 2025, in New Albany, Indiana. A man of integrity and unwavering truth, Greg was not just a master electrician who owned Masingo Electrical Contracting; he was a beacon of light in the lives of those who knew him.
A true baseball enthusiast, Greg's heart resonated with the spirit of the Cincinnati Reds. His passion for the sport sparkled in every conversation, igniting joy and camaraderie among fellow fans. Yet, beyond the confines of the ballpark, it was his profound love for his children and grandchildren that defined him. Greg devoted countless hours to nurturing their dreams, often found volunteering at the Charlestown Little League, or cheering them on at other sporting events. His enthusiasm was seen and heard amongst all in attendance, as he watched each game/match unfold before him.
Greg's family, who carry his legacy, remember him as a pillar of strength and sincerity. He is survived by his son, Dustin Masingo, and his cherished daughter, Toni, alongside her husband Nick Shaw. His son Marc, and his wife Ariel, will forever hold dear their father's lessons, etched in the very fabric of their hearts. Siblings David 'Sinker' Masingo and his wife Trudi, Beverly 'Sissy' Masingo, and brother JD Masingo, with his wife JoAnn, reflect on fond memories shared with a man whose laughter and honesty were infectious.
Greg's grandchildren— Jack Shaw, Ella Shaw, Emma Shaw, John-Wyatt Masingo, Retty Masingo, Russell Masingo, Renea Twigg, Sarah Masingo, Gracie Masingo, Tate Masingo, Tinsley Masingo, and Peyton Masingo—will carry forward the unwavering spirit and love he bestowed upon them. Each of them was graced not only with his presence but with the values he instilled, which will resonate through generations.
Regrettably, Greg's journey was shaped by the absence of his beloved parents, JD and Earline Masingo, who have preceded him. Yet, in his departure, Greg leaves behind a tapestry of cherished memories and boundless love, a testament to a life beautifully lived and deeply felt.
In celebrating Greg L. Masingo, we acknowledge a man whose truthfulness, passion for baseball, and love for his family created an indelible mark on the hearts of all he encountered. His vibrant legacy will endure, forever woven into the stories and lives of those who were truly fortunate to call him family and friend.
Burial will be held privately at a later date.
Expressions of sympathy can take the form of donations to the Charlestown Little League in Greg's honor at P.O. Box 266, Charlestown, IN 47111
